1. Explore Kathmandu in 2 Days: 5 UNESCO and Nagarkot Sunrise Tour

Explore Kathmandu in 2 Days: 5 UNESCO and Nagarkot Sunrise Tour

Kathmandu Valley UNESCO Tour is a fantastic way to get a broad sense of Nepal’s rich cultural tapestry in just two days. This tour covers Patan Durbar Square, where hundreds of Hindu and Buddhist idols decorate ancient temples, and the intricate wood carvings showcase centuries of craftsmanship. Day 1 includes visits to Pashupatinath Temple, famous for its Shiva lingam and open cremations along the Bagmati River, and Boudhanath Stupa, a striking Tibetan Buddhist site with monasteries and prayer flags fluttering everywhere. The day ends at Swayambhunath, or Monkey Temple, perched atop a hill, offering sweeping views over Kathmandu.

On Day 2, the tour explores Lalitpur’s Patan Durbar Square, famed for its architecture and art. The guide shares insights into the Newar culture that flourished in these squares for centuries. 2. Lumbini Pilgrimage Tour by Flight- 2 Days

Lumbini Pilgrimage Tour by Flight- 2 Days

If spiritual significance tops your list, the Lumbini Pilgrimage Tour by Flight offers an efficient way to visit the birth place of Buddha within two days. Starting early with a transfer to Kathmandu’s domestic airport, you’ll fly to Bhairahawa, then visit key sites like the Maya Devi Temple, where Buddha was born. Surrounding this sacred area are monasteries representing different Buddhist traditions, the Ashoka Pillar — the oldest relic — and the Lumbini Crane Sanctuary, home to the national bird.

This tour is ideal for those interested in religion, history, or culture, with a focus on meaningful encounters. 3. From Kathmandu: Nagarkot Tour Package 1 Night 2 Days

From Kathmandu: Nagarkot Tour Package 1 Nights 2 Days

For lovers of mountain scenery, the Nagarkot Tour is a highlight. This tour takes you to a hilltop village about 32 km east of Kathmandu, famous for its spectacular sunrise over the Himalayas. The itinerary includes sightseeing at Changunarayan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age site, and plenty of opportunities to enjoy panoramic views of peaks like Everest, Annapurna, and Manaslu on clear days.

4. Nagarkot Trekking in Kathmandu Nepal (1 Night / 2 Days)

Nagarkot Trekking in Kathmandu Nepal (1 Night / 2 Days)

If you’re interested in combining trekking with cultural exploration, this private Nagarkot trek offers a flexible, personalized experience. Starting from Sankhu village, you’ll hike approximately 3 hours up to Nagarkot, enjoying terraced fields and village life along the way. Wake early for the sunrise over the Himalayas from Nagarkot’s vantage point, then descend through forests to Changu Narayan, one of Nepal’s oldest temples.

6. 2 Days Ghorepani Poonhill Trek from Pokhara

2 Days Ghorepani Poonhill Trek from Pokhara

The Ghorepani Poonhill Trek is a short trek perfect for beginners or travelers with limited time. Starting from Pokhara, you’ll drive approximately 4 hours to Banthanti, then hike through rhododendron forests and Gurung villages. The highlight is reaching Poonhill early morning for a breathtaking sunrise over the Himalayas, including Annapurna, Dhaulagiri, and Machhapuchhre.

How to Choose Your 2-Day Tour in Kathmandu

When selecting a tour, consider your budget, physical activity level, and interests. For culture, the Explore Kathmandu in 2 Days is hard to beat. If you’re after mountain scenery, Nagarkot tours offer spectacular vistas. For spiritual journeys, the Lumbini Pilgrimage Tour provides a meaningful visit, while outdoor enthusiasts might prefer trekking options like Ghorepani Poonhill.

Practical tips include booking early, especially for popular tours like Nagarkot hikes or the Lumbini flight, and considering the weather — the best mountain views are generally in clear seasons from October to April. Remember, some tours include private guides or accommodations, which can enhance your experience but also increase costs.
